0 Votes

Changes for page Start here if you're new

Last modified by Ryan C on 2025/06/28 04:59

From version 8.1
edited by Ryan C
on 2025/03/16 01:18
Change comment: There is no comment for this version
To version 15.1
edited by Ryan C
on 2025/05/14 13:29
Change comment: There is no comment for this version

Summary

Details

Page properties
Content
... ... @@ -2,10 +2,8 @@
2 2  
3 3  ----
4 4  
5 -== Getting Started with XWiki ==
5 +== ==
6 6  
7 -This page covers all the essential steps and tips you need to create great content in XWiki without any confusion.
8 -
9 9  == πŸ“– Table of Contents: ==
10 10  
11 11  {{toc/}}
... ... @@ -12,6 +12,12 @@
12 12  
13 13  ----
14 14  
13 +== Getting Started with XWiki ==
14 +
15 +This page covers all the essential steps and tips you need to create great content in XWiki without any confusion.
16 +
17 +== ==
18 +
15 15  == πŸ“Ž **Attachments and Images** ==
16 16  
17 17  You can easily upload files and images directly from the WYSIWYG editor:
... ... @@ -92,10 +92,6 @@
92 92  * **Wiki Editor**: This mode enables direct editing using XWiki’s markup syntax. It’s suitable for users comfortable with wiki syntax and those requiring precise control over the content structure.ξˆ†
93 93  * **Inline Form Editing**: Used primarily for pages containing structured data or custom applications, this mode presents editable fields directly within the page view, streamlining data entry and updates.ξˆ†
94 94  
95 -=== **Switching Between Syntaxes** ===
96 -
97 -XWiki supports multiple syntaxes, including XWiki 2.1, MediaWiki, and others. While it’s possible to switch a page’s syntax, exercise caution, as certain syntaxes may not fully support WYSIWYG editing. For instance, changing a page to MediaWiki syntax might limit the availability of the WYSIWYG editor. ξˆ€citeξˆ‚turn0search6ξˆξˆ†
98 -
99 99  == **Essential Formatting Options** ==
100 100  
101 101  To ensure content is both engaging and accessible, utilize the following formatting techniques:ξˆ†
... ... @@ -112,7 +112,8 @@
112 112  === **Text Formatting** ===
113 113  
114 114  
115 -*
115 +
116 +*
116 116  ** (((
117 117  === **Bold**: Surround text with double asterisks. ===
118 118  )))
... ... @@ -121,7 +121,8 @@
121 121  **bold text**
122 122  {{/code}}
123 123  
124 -*
125 +
126 +*
125 125  ** (((
126 126  === **Italics**: Use double underscores. ===
127 127  )))
... ... @@ -130,7 +130,8 @@
130 130  __italic text__
131 131  {{/code}}
132 132  
133 -*
135 +
136 +*
134 134  ** (((
135 135  === **Underline**: Enclose text with double tildes. ===
136 136  )))
... ... @@ -139,10 +139,8 @@
139 139  ~~underlined text~~
140 140  {{/code}}
141 141  
142 -*
143 -*
144 144  
145 -*
146 +*
146 146  ** (((
147 147  === **Unordered List**: Begin lines with asterisk (*) or hyphen (-). ===
148 148  )))
... ... @@ -152,7 +152,8 @@
152 152  * Item 2
153 153  {{/code}}
154 154  
155 -*
156 +
157 +*
156 156  ** (((
157 157  === **Ordered List**: Start lines with a number followed by a period. ===
158 158  )))
... ... @@ -162,15 +162,11 @@
162 162  2. Second item
163 163  {{/code}}
164 164  
165 -* (((
166 -=== ===
167 -)))
168 -* (((
169 -=== **Links** ===
170 -)))
171 171  
168 +== **Links** ==
172 172  
173 173  
171 +
174 174  ==== **Internal Link**: Use square brackets with the page name. ====
175 175  
176 176  {{code}}
... ... @@ -177,16 +177,15 @@
177 177  [[PageName]]
178 178  {{/code}}
179 179  
180 -*
181 -** (((
178 +
179 +
182 182  ==== **External Link**: Provide the URL directly. ====
183 -)))
184 184  
185 185  {{code}}
186 186  [https://www.example.com]
187 187  {{/code}}
188 188  
189 -* (((
186 +(((
190 190  === **Images** ===
191 191  )))
192 192  
... ... @@ -199,17 +199,17 @@
199 199  
200 200  Macros are powerful tools in XWiki that allow for dynamic content inclusion and advanced formatting. Here are ten notable macros to consider:ξˆ†
201 201  
202 -1. **Box Macro**: Encapsulates content within a styled box, useful for highlighting information.ξˆ†
199 +== Embed Macro ==
203 203  
204 -{{code}}
205 -{{box}}
206 -Your content here.
207 -{{/box}}
208 -{{/code}}
201 +The Embed macro shows external content like YouTube videos.
209 209  
203 +{{example}}
204 +{{embed url="https://www.youtube.com/watch?v=dQw4w9WgXcQ"/}}
205 +{{/example}}
210 210  
211 -=== **Info Macro**: Displays an informational message, often used for tips or notes.ξˆ† ===
212 212  
208 +=== **Info Macro**: Displays an informational message, often used for tips or notes. ===
209 +
213 213  {{code}}
214 214  {{info}}
215 215  This is an informational note.
... ... @@ -217,17 +217,18 @@
217 217  {{/code}}
218 218  
219 219  
220 -=== **Warning Macro**: Highlights warnings or important notices.ξˆ† ===
217 +== Footnote Macro ==
221 221  
222 -{{code}}
223 -{{warning}}
224 -Caution: Proceed with care.
225 -{{/warning}}
226 -{{/code}}
219 +The Footnote macro adds footnotes to the page.
227 227  
221 +{{example}}
222 +This is a statement{{footnote}}Source: Example Reference{{/footnote}}.
223 +{{putFootnotes/}}
224 +{{/example}}
228 228  
229 -=== **Code Macro**: Renders code snippets with syntax highlighting.ξˆ† ===
230 230  
227 +=== **Code Macro**: Renders code snippets with syntax highlighting. ===
228 +
231 231  {{code}}
232 232  {{code language="python"}}
233 233  def hello_world():
... ... @@ -236,7 +236,7 @@
236 236  {{/code}}
237 237  
238 238  
239 -=== **Gallery Macro**: Creates an image gallery from attached images.ξˆ† ===
237 +=== **Gallery Macro**: Creates an image gallery from attached images. ===
240 240  
241 241  {{code}}
242 242  {{gallery}}
... ... @@ -252,28 +252,60 @@
252 252  {{toc/}}
253 253  {{/code}}
254 254  
253 +== Video Macro ==
255 255  
256 -=== **Include Macro**: Embeds content from another page. ===
255 +The Video macro embeds videos.
257 257  
258 -{{code}}
259 -{{include reference="PageName"/}}
260 -{{/code}}
257 +{{example}}
258 +{{video url="https://www.youtube.com/watch?v=dQw4w9WgXcQ"/}}
259 +{{/example}}
261 261  
261 +== Expandable Macro ==
262 +The following example demonstrates how to present complex information cleanly using `{{expandable}}` and `{{example}}`.
262 262  
263 -=== **Display Macro**: Displays the content of another document or an object property. ===
264 +{{example}}
265 +{{expandable summary="🧠 Study: Survey of Expert Opinion on Intelligence"}}
266 +**Source:** *Intelligence (Elsevier)*
267 +**Date:** *2019*
268 +**Authors:** *Heiner Rindermann, David Becker, Thomas R. Coyle*
269 +**DOI:** [10.1016/j.intell.2019.101406](https://doi.org/10.1016/j.intell.2019.101406)
270 +**Subject:** *Psychology, Intelligence Research*
264 264  
265 -{{code}}
266 -{{display reference="PageName"/}}
267 -{{/code}}
272 +{{expandable summary="πŸ“Š Key Statistics"}}
273 +- Survey of **102 intelligence experts**
274 +- **90% from Western countries**, **83% male**
275 +- **54% left-liberal**, **24% conservative**
276 +- **50/50 split** on genetic vs environmental causes of Black-White IQ gap
277 +{{/expandable}}
268 268  
279 +{{expandable summary="πŸ”¬ Findings"}}
280 +- Support for **g-factor theory**
281 +- Agreement on **heritability of intelligence**
282 +- Political lean: left = environmental, right = genetic causes
283 +{{/expandable}}
269 269  
270 -=== **Velocity Macro**: Executes Velocity scripts for dynamic content generation. ===
285 +{{expandable summary="πŸ“ Critique"}}
286 +- Largest expert survey on intelligence
287 +- **Western-only sample**, possible **self-selection bias**
288 +{{/expandable}}
271 271  
272 -{{code}}
273 -{{velocity}}
274 -#set($greeting = "Hello, $user.name!")
275 -$greeting
276 -{{/velocity}}
277 -{{/code}}
290 +{{expandable summary="πŸ“Œ Relevance"}}
291 +- Shows **ideological divide** in science
292 +- Highlights **media vs expert disconnect**
293 +{{/expandable}}
278 278  
279 -
295 +{{expandable summary="πŸ” Explore More"}}
296 +- Global surveys on intelligence beliefs
297 +- Media analysis follow-up studies
298 +{{/expandable}}
299 +
300 +{{expandable summary="πŸ“„ Download"}}
301 +[[Download Study>>attach:10.1016_j.intell.2019.101406.pdf]]
302 +{{/expandable}}
303 +{{/expandable}}
304 +{{/example}}
305 +
306 +
307 +== See Also: ==
308 +
309 +[[Syntax Help official documentation for a full list of formatting options>>doc:XWiki.XWikiSyntax]]